Understanding Market Shifts:
Market shifts represent a dynamic environment where customer preferences, market dynamics, and technology converge in unpredictable ways. Identifying and adapting to these shifts is crucial for businesses to maintain their competitive edge.
Evaluating Key Metrics:
Customer Insights: Analyzing customer feedback, surveys, and demographic data provides valuable insights into evolving customer behavior and preferences.
Market Research: Conducting thorough research on market trends, competitor analysis, and emerging technologies helps identify potential opportunities and threats.
Financial Statements: Understanding key financial metrics like revenue, expenses, and cash flow allows businesses to assess their financial health and adapt their strategy accordingly.
Social Media Listening: Monitoring and analyzing social media conversations provides valuable feedback on customer sentiment and emerging trends.
Adapting Strategies:
Dynamic Pricing: Adjusting prices based on demand, competition, and market fluctuations ensures optimal revenue and profitability.
Product Diversification: Expanding product portfolio with complementary offerings helps mitigate risks associated with market downturns or customer dissatisfaction.
Channel Management: Optimizing distribution channels and marketing efforts ensures efficient customer reach and brand awareness.
Marketing Mix Adjustments: Modifying pricing, promotion, advertising, and other marketing activities align with changing customer preferences and market dynamics.
Monitoring and Measuring Success:
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s): Define relevant metrics to track progress and measure the effectiveness of implemented strategies.
Data-Driven Decision Making: Regularly analyze and interpret data to identify market trends, customer behavior, and optimize strategy.
Performance-Based Incentives: Offering incentives and rewards for achieving strategic goals motivates employees and aligns their efforts with business objectives.
Conclusion:
Adapting to continuous market shifts requires continuous monitoring, strategic planning, and agile decision-making. By implementing these practices, businesses can maintain their competitive edge, navigate market turbulence, and achieve sustainable growth
